Understanding the Challenges Faced by UK SMEs

The Landscape of UK SMEs

According to the Federation of Small Businesses, there are approximately 5.5 million SMEs in the UK, making up 99.9% of the business population. These enterprises are crucial to the UK economy, contributing around 52% of all private sector turnover. However, many SMEs are grappling with significant challenges that hinder their growth and efficiency:

  1. Limited Resources: Many SMEs operate with constrained budgets, making it difficult to invest in advanced IT infrastructure.
  2. Cybersecurity Threats: As cyberattacks become more sophisticated, SMEs are increasingly targeted due to perceived vulnerabilities.
  3. Inefficient Processes: Outdated systems can lead to inefficiencies, hampering productivity and innovation.
  4. Remote Work Adaptation: The COVID-19 pandemic accelerated the shift to remote work, exposing gaps in IT capabilities and collaboration tools.

The Pain Points

1. Resource Constraints

For many SMEs, the limited budget is a significant barrier to adopting new technologies. Traditional IT solutions often require high upfront investments, which can drain finances and divert attention from core business functions.

2. Cybersecurity Risks

Cybersecurity is a growing concern for SMEs. According to the Cyber Security Breaches Survey 2022, 39% of businesses reported experiencing a cyberattack. With limited cybersecurity expertise and resources, many SMEs find themselves vulnerable to data breaches, ransomware, and other threats.

3. Inefficient Operations

Many SMEs rely on legacy systems that are not only costly to maintain but also slow down operational processes. Manual tasks can lead to human error, decreased productivity, and missed opportunities for growth.

4. Adapting to Remote Work

As remote work becomes more prevalent, SMEs face challenges in ensuring their teams stay connected and productive. Traditional IT setups may lack the flexibility required for a distributed workforce.

What is Cloud Computing?

Cloud computing allows businesses to store and manage data and applications over the internet instead of relying on local servers or personal computers. This shift offers numerous advantages, especially for SMEs.

Benefits of Cloud Solutions for UK SMEs

  1. Cost Efficiency: With cloud services, SMEs can adopt a pay-as-you-go model, reducing the need for large upfront investments. This flexibility allows businesses to allocate resources more effectively.

  2. Scalability: Cloud solutions can easily scale with your business. Whether you’re looking to expand your operations or adjust to seasonal demands, cloud services can grow alongside you.

  3. Enhanced Collaboration: Cloud-based tools facilitate real-time collaboration among team members, regardless of their physical location. This is particularly important for remote teams, improving communication and productivity.

  1. Access to Advanced Technologies: Cloud providers offer a plethora of tools and services, including AI, machine learning, and analytics, allowing SMEs to leverage technology that was previously out of reach.

Strengthening Cybersecurity

As SMEs transition to cloud solutions, itโ€™s crucial to prioritise cybersecurity to protect sensitive data and maintain customer trust.

Key Cybersecurity Strategies

  1. Regular Security Audits: Conducting regular audits helps identify vulnerabilities and ensures that security protocols are up to date.

  2. Employee Training: Educating employees on cybersecurity best practices, such as recognising phishing attempts and using strong passwords, is vital to reducing risks.

  1.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): Implementing MFA adds an extra layer of security, making it harder for cybercriminals to access sensitive information.

  2. Data Encryption: Encrypting data both in transit and at rest ensures that even if data is intercepted, it remains unreadable without the proper decryption keys.

Implementing Managed IT Services

Managed IT services offer SMEs a comprehensive solution to handle their IT needs without the burden of maintaining an in-house team.

The Advantages of Managed IT Services

  1. Expertise on Demand: Managed IT service providers offer access to a team of experts who can address specific needs, ensuring that your business stays up to date with the latest technologies and best practices.
  1. 24/7 Support: With managed IT services, you gain access to round-the-clock support, ensuring that any IT issues can be resolved swiftly, minimising downtime.

  2. Focus on Core Business: By outsourcing IT management, SMEs can focus on their core business activities rather than getting bogged down by technical issues.

  3. Proactive Maintenance: Managed IT services include regular maintenance and updates, reducing the risk of unexpected failures and security breaches.
